Miranda, Irma Iunes Yacovenco, Lilian Coutinho Tesch, Leila Maria Meireles, Alexsandro Rodrigues The style variation in different reading situations: Capixaba variety <p></p><p>Abstract The style, along with linguistic and social resources, integrates the study of sociolinguistic variation. Based on W. Labov perspective, who mainly focused on the attention that the speaker pays to his/her own speech when he analysed stylistic variation, this research aims to observe possible stylistic differences between sentence reading (type “Digo palavra baixinho”) and text reading (type children's tale). The parameters analysed for such purposes are the frequencies of the first an second formants (F1 and F2) of stressed and pre-stressed vowels, the duration of those vowels (Dur) and their spectral emphasis (SE). The result confirmed that different styles promote different reactions in readers: the decontextualized sentences reading produced a more monitored speach than the text reading.</p><p></p> Style;Acoustic analysis;Vowel system;Brazilian Portuguese;Capixaba dialect 2017-12-05
